#37f6da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#37f6da is composed of 21.6% red, 96.5%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.4%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 171.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 59%. #37f6da color hex could be obtained by blending #6effff with #00edb5.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#37f6da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000606 is the darkest color, while #f3f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#37f6da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9e9c is the less saturated color, while #2ffee0 is the most saturated one.
